Nebraska Baseball Wins Another Home Game
No. 19 Huskers rally to defeat Penn State at Haymarket Park
Apr. 5, 2026 at 11:19pm
Got story updates? Submit your updates here. ›
The No. 19 Nebraska baseball team continued its dominant home performance, rallying to defeat Penn State 15-0 at Haymarket Park on Sunday. The Huskers, who are now 15-0 at home this season, were led by a quality start from pitcher Cooper Katskee.
Why it matters
Nebraska's undefeated home record has been a key factor in their strong start to the season. The Huskers have established Haymarket Park as a tough place for opponents to play, giving them a significant home-field advantage as they compete for a spot in the NCAA tournament.
The details
Cooper Katskee turned in a quality start for the Huskers, pitching 6 innings and allowing just 2 runs. Nebraska's offense then rallied to score 13 unanswered runs and secure the victory. This continues a trend of strong performances at home for the Huskers, who have now won 15 straight games at Haymarket Park.
